Question 602153: Trains A and B are traveling in the same direction on parallel
track. Train A is traveling at 80 miles per hour and train B is
traveling at 100 miles per hour. Train A passes a station at 3:20 am.
If train B passes the same station at 3:35 am ., at what time will
train B catch up to train A? Answer by mananth(16946) (Show Source):
You can put this solution on YOUR website! the distance traveled by both is same when one catches up with the other.
Let them meet at distance x
Train A speed= 80 mph , starts at 03:20 pm
Train B speed= 100 mph starts at 03:35 pm
Time difference between the starting of the two= 0.25 hours
Time taken by Train A = X / 80
Time taken by Train B = X / 100
X / 80 - X / 100 = 0.25
LCD - 400
Multiply equation by 400
400 / 80 x- 400 / 100 x= 0.25 * 400
5 x - 4 x = 100
1 x = 100
/ 1
x= 100 miles
Train A speed= 80 mph
Distance = 100 miles
Time taken = 100 / 80
Time taken = 1.25 hour
They will be together at 04:35 pm
Train B catches up at 4:35 pm
